Output 43108dbbbcad0f39e923d43a33e4f9cdce3a716032fe9e4b891cddf97b2f0873:1

value
625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c23393232f13af36d6a3dafd7b3429ec4324ed OP_EQUAL
address
DMSHTkwuvt33eEwKeZRZobtHU1vvfoUpJZ
transaction
43108dbbbcad0f39e923d43a33e4f9cdce3a716032fe9e4b891cddf97b2f0873
spent
true